Shell Tellus Oils T
Multigrade hydraulic oil


Premium performance, anti-wear hydraulic oils which incorporate a special viscosity index improver additive to enhance their viscosity/temperature characteristics.


Applications:
Hydraulic and fluid power transmission systems subjected to wide variations in temperature or where low viscosity change
with fluctuating temperature is required. Certain critical hydraulic systems can only tolerate small variations in viscosity with fluctuating temperature if efficiency and responsiveness are
to be maintained.

Hydraulic oils, such as Shell Tellus Oil T, which exhibit multigrade viscosity characteristics may be used to particular advantage in these circumstances.


Performance Features:
Very low viscosity variation with temperature Special viscosity index technology minimises the oil's variation in viscosity with changes in temperature and provides good
pumpability at low temperatures. These features are particularly beneficial in hydraulic applications subjected to extremes of temperature.


High shear stability:
The 'VI' improver is highly resistant to mechanical stress. The maintenance of 'stay-in-grade' characteristics ensures effective lubrication and long oil life.
Outstanding anti-wear performance Proven anti-wear additives are effective in all operating conditions, including low and severe duty, high load situations.


Excellent filterability:
Minimal tendency to cause filter blockage in the presence of contaminants such as water and calcium. Oxidation resistant
Resist the formation of acidic products and sludge, even at high working temperatures.


Corrosion protection:
Powerful inhibitors provide long term protection against corrosion of both ferrous and non-ferrous metals. Rapid air release and anti-foam properties provide air release without excessive foaming.


Compatibility:
The anti-wear additive technology used in Shell Tellus Oils T is based upon zinc which, although ideal for most hydraulic pumps, should not be used in those of older design containing silverplated components. Shell Tellus Oils R should be used for these applications.


Seal & Paint Compatibility:
Shell Tellus Oils T are compatible with all seal materials and paints normally specified for use with mineral oils.


Health & Safety
Shell Tellus Oils T are unlikely to present any significant health or safety hazard when properly used in the recommended application, and good standards of industrial and personal hygiene are maintained.
Avoid contact with skin. Use impervious gloves with used oil. After skin contact, wash immediately with soap and water.
For further guidance on Product Health & Safety refer to the appropriate Shell Product Safety Data Sheet.


Protect the environment:

Typical Physical Characteristics:
 

Shell Tellus Oil T15 T37 T46 T68 T100
ISO Oil Type HV HV HV HV HV
Kinematic Viscosity @ 0°C cSt  (IP 71) 79 296 392 637 1041
Kinematic Viscosity @ 20°C cSt  (IP 71) 31 90 116 179 276
Kinematic Viscosity @40°C cSt  (IP 71) 15 37 46 68 100
Kinematic Viscosity @ 100°C cSt  (IP 71) 3.8 6.9 8.1 10.9 14.5
Viscosity Index ( IP 226) 150 150 150 150 150
Density @ 15 °C kg/l (IP 365) 0.877 0.872 0.876 0.880 0.884
Flash Point °C (Pensky-Martens Closed Cup) (IP 34) 150 185 180 186 190
Pour Point °C (IP 15) -42 -39 -39 -36 -30
Air Release Value Minutes to 0.2% air @ 50°C (IP 313) 3 4 6 8 10
Aniline Point °C (IP 2) 90 98 99 103 107
Copper Corrosion 3 hours @ 100 °C
 (IP 154)
class 1 class 1 class 1 class 1 class 1
Foaming Characteristics:          
Sequence 1,Tendency/Stability, ml @ 24 °C 20/NIL 30/NIL 30/NIL 30/NIL 50/NIL
Sequence 2,Tendency/Stability, ml @ 93.5 °C 10/NIL 20/NIL 40/NIL 40/NIL 40/NIL
Tendency/Stability, after test @ 93.5 °C,
ml @ 24 °C (IP 146)
20/NIL 30/NIL 30/NIL 30/NIL 50/NIL
Neutralisation Number mg KOH/g (IP 139) 1.0 1.0 1.0 1.0 1.0
